Memristor Market Overview    

Growth in this market is being driven by increasing demand for energy-efficient memory technologies across consumer electronics, edge computing, and AI hardware. Memristors offer compact, low-power solutions capable of storing and processing data simultaneously, which is essential for real time learning and adaptive systems. Their ability to replicate synaptic behaviour makes them particularly valuable in neuromorphic computing, where traditional memory architectures fall short in speed and scalability.

Another key factor is the surge in research and development focused on next-generation computing platforms. Institutions and companies are investing in memristor based designs to overcome limitations in conventional semiconductor technologies. As data-intensive applications expand from autonomous vehicles to intelligent sensors memristors provide a pathway to faster, more efficient memory integration, positioning them as a cornerstone of future digital infrastructure.

Memristor Market Dynamics 

Memristors Power the Future of Intelligent AI Systems

Growing interest in artificial intelligence is boosting the need for faster, energy efficient memory systems. Memristors meet this demand by enabling real time learning and low power data processing, making them ideal for next-generation AI hardware. Their ability to mimic neural behavior allows systems to adapt and respond dynamically, improving performance in edge computing and autonomous applications. This positions memristors as a key component in the evolution of intelligent, scalable technologies.

In 2025, researchers at the Korea Advanced Institute of Science and Technology (KAIST) developed a brain-on a chip using memristor technology. This chip mimics synaptic behavior, allowing it to learn and adapt like human neurons. It processes and stores data simultaneously, making it highly energy efficient and suitable for advanced artificial intelligence (AI) systems. The innovation marks a step toward the concept of technological singularity where AI could match or surpass human intelligence.

Manufacturing Challenges Limit Memristor Market Expansion

Manufacturing complexity is a key restraint in the memristor market. Producing memristors at scale requires precise control over materials and nanoscale fabrication, which can lead to inconsistent performance and high defect rates. Integrating them into existing semiconductor processes also poses challenges, slowing down commercialization and increasing production costs. These hurdles limit widespread adoption despite strong interest from AI and computing sectors.

Smart Infrastructure Drives Memristor Adoption in Telecom

IT and telecommunication sector is a rapidly growing segment in the memristor market, driven by the need for faster data transmission, real-time processing, and energy-efficient infrastructure. Memristors support in-memory computing and neuromorphic architectures, which are increasingly vital for managing complex network traffic and enabling intelligent edge devices. Their ability to reduce latency and power consumption makes them ideal for telecom applications such as 5G base stations, AI-enhanced routing, and data center optimization

For instance, in June 2025, researchers from Peking University and the Chinese Institute for Brain Research unveiled a memristor-based sorting system that enhances AI efficiency. Published in Nature Electronics, it delivers 7.7× faster throughput, 160× better energy efficiency, and 32× improved memory use advancing intelligent computing through sort-in-memory architecture.

Memristor Market Sustainability Analysis

Memristor technology offers notable sustainability benefits by reducing energy consumption in data processing and storage. Unlike traditional memory systems, memristors combine computation and memory in a single unit, minimizing data transfer and lowering power usage. Their compact design and potential for long-term durability also support efficient hardware scaling, making them suitable for eco-conscious AI and edge computing applications. As demand for low-power electronics grows, memristors contribute to greener, more sustainable digital infrastructure.

Key Developments of the Memristor Market

  • March 2026: Researchers at the University of Cambridge developed a hafnium-oxide memristor with switching currents nearly one million times lower than conventional oxide-based devices, representing a major breakthrough in ultra-low-power neuromorphic computing. The new architecture delivers highly uniform switching, hundreds of conductance states, and up to 70% AI energy-reduction potential, advancing next-generation AI hardware and in-memory computing.
  • January 2025: Researchers at The University of Tokyo announced a giant resistance-change memristor capable of storing magnetic-field history, expanding memristor functionality beyond conventional memory applications. The innovation demonstrated enhanced non-volatile memory behavior and opens new opportunities for magnetic sensing, neuromorphic systems, and advanced data-storage technologies.
  • March 2025: Scientists at Forschungszentrum Jülich unveiled novel memristive devices designed to overcome AI’s “catastrophic forgetting” problem, a key limitation in continual learning systems. The new memristors operate with extremely low power consumption, support both analog and digital modes, and exhibit improved robustness across wider voltage ranges, strengthening the future of brain-inspired computing architectures.
